Bishkek, June 11, 2024./Kabar/.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Kyrgyz Republic Jeenbek Kulubaev received Ambassador of the Russian Federation to Kyrgyzstan Nikolai Udovichenko on the occasion of the completion of his diplomatic mission.
According to the press service of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Kyrgyz Republic, during the conversation, the minister congratulated the ambassador on the upcoming national holiday - Russia Day, expressed gratitude to him for the work done and personal contribution to the development of bilateral relations between Kyrgyzstan and Russia. He noted that during his work as the Russian ambassador to the Kyrgyz Republic, relations between the two states moved to a new level of strategic partnership.
The parties discussed the implementation of the agreements reached at the highest and high levels, as well as the preparation of the upcoming XXV meeting of the intergovernmental Kyrgyz-Russian Commission on Trade, Economic, Scientific, Technical and Humanitarian Cooperation and the XI Kyrgyz-Russian Interregional Conference, which will be held in July this year in Krasnoyarsk.
In turn, the ambassador thanked the Kyrgyz side for their support in fulfilling his duties and noted that he would continue to make efforts to further deepen bilateral cooperation with Kyrgyzstan.
